- Bengal_Club abstract "The Bengal Club is a social club in Kolkata, West Bengal. It was opened in 1827 as the Calcutta United Service Club. The club's first President was Lt. Col. The Hon. J. Finch. The club-house was in a building in Esplanade West, erected in 1813. The club has a dining hall, a number of bars, libraries and a gymnasium and is built in the colonial style. Members are also able to visit other reciprocal clubs around India, as well as many parts of the world. The Club has strict dress regulations.
